kingcaid is the solo project of Michael Kingcaid, former frontman and songwriter for the Austin-based indie rock band What Made Milwaukee Famous (Barsuk Records). Known for his evocative lyricism and dynamic performances, Kingcaid channels his experience into a more dense, cinematic, pop sound under the kingcaid moniker.
Blending moody rock textures with atmospheric storytelling, kingcaid draws inspiration from Deer Tick, Queens of the Stone Age, Elliott Smith, Spoon, and Rufus Wainwright. His music captures the emotional weight of longing and redemption, with arrangements that feel both intimate and expansive.
